The $8 Billion Overhaul of LaGuardia Airport: Engineering a New Era | NOVA | PBS
Summary
TLDRLaGuardia Airport, once one of the most dreaded in the U.S., has undergone a transformative $8 billion redevelopment. The project, the first in over 25 years, upgraded terminals and introduced cutting-edge engineering to improve functionality and aesthetics. Key features include pedestrian bridges built above the tarmac, a striking Oculus entrance flooding Terminal C with light, and flood-resistant design elements. With future-proofing for extreme weather, LaGuardia has become a state-of-the-art airport, offering a world-class experience for around 14 million passengers annually.
Takeaways
- π LaGuardia Airport has long been overshadowed by its larger counterparts, JFK and Newark.
- π In 2016, an $8 billion plan was launched to transform LaGuardia, marking one of the most significant airport redevelopment projects in U.S. history.
- π The transformation included complete makeovers of Terminals B and C, with key upgrades to enhance the airport's infrastructure.
- π LaGuardia went from being one of the most disliked airports to one of the best in the country, all while maintaining flight schedules.
- π The construction team built two massive pedestrian bridges to connect the new Terminal B to its concourses, using different engineering techniques.
- π The Eastern Bridge was built piece by piece on temporary towers, meeting 65 feet above the ground.
- π The Western Bridge was assembled on the ground in six massive sections, each weighing tons, before being lifted into place.
- π Terminal C, expected to handle around 14 million passengers annually, features a 15,000 square foot Oculus to flood the entrance with natural light.
- π The Oculus was constructed from nearly 400 pieces of interlocking steel and was hoisted into place as one complete truss.
- π LaGuardia's redevelopment includes future-proofing measures such as innovative heating and cooling systems to handle extreme weather and flood-resistant designs to protect against storm surges.
Q & A
What was LaGuardia Airport's reputation before the redevelopment?
-LaGuardia was one of the most dreaded airports in the country, standing in the shadow of its larger siblings, JFK and Newark.
How much did the redevelopment project of LaGuardia cost?
-The redevelopment project cost $8 billion.
What significant change happened in 2016 regarding LaGuardia Airport?
-In 2016, a plan was launched to completely transform LaGuardia Airport, marking the beginning of one of the most significant airport redevelopment projects in U.S. history.
What are the main elements of the new LaGuardia Airport project?
-The main elements include complete overhauls of Terminals B and C, the addition of two pedestrian bridges, and the construction of a new terminal (Terminal C) and concourses.
What innovative construction methods were used for the pedestrian bridges at LaGuardia?
-The Eastern Bridge was built using temporary towers and assembled piece by piece, while the Western Bridge was constructed in six massive sections on the ground and then lifted into place.
How does the Oculus in Terminal C contribute to the airportβs design?
-The Oculus is a 15,000 square foot opening designed to flood the entrance with light. It was constructed from almost 400 interlocking steel pieces.
How was the Oculus structure installed?
-The main truss of the Oculus was raised in one piece, hoisted 100 feet into the air with a crane, and then bolted into place by a team of ironworkers.
How is LaGuardia Airport being adapted for future climate challenges?
-LaGuardia has been designed with systems to both heat and cool the airport, making it adaptable to changing New York climate conditions.
What measures were taken to protect LaGuardia from storm surges and flooding?
-To protect from flooding, the Concourse G of Terminal C was designed to sit on 20-foot concrete columns, allowing floodwaters to pass underneath without causing damage.
What overall impact did the redevelopment have on LaGuardia Airportβs status?
-The redevelopment transformed LaGuardia from one of the most dreaded airports to one of the best in the country, with modern engineering and architecture making it a cutting-edge facility.
